InetAddress----IP地址


端口号

协议(UDP/TCP)




JAVA操作-UDP


一发一收模式


多发多收

这块服务器端是可以接收多个客户端请求的
测试的话 就是把客户端多启用几个 把客户端的设置的端口7777去掉,不然启动多个报端口冲突
如果不知道如何启动多个客户端可参考截图(IDEA中一个程序只能启动一次即单开的,想启动多次的设置)点击下面apply(ok)应用即可

JAVA操作-TCP



一发一收

多发多收

服务端代码优化,如果客户端挂了,服务端这边会抛出异常




实现群聊功能
代码视频


BS架构



线程池优化


